TACLOBAN CITY – The city government of Borongan will host the swimwear competition of the Miss Philippines Earth 2024.

The Borongan delegation, led by City Mayor Jose Ivan Dayan Agda met with the Carousel Productions of Miss Earth to finalize the upcoming visit of reigning queens and 2024 candidates to Borongan City and Eastern Samar for a 5-day tour and advocacy drive.
“We are thrilled to host Miss Earth and welcome the reigning queens and 2024 candidates to Borongan City, Eastern Samar,” Mayor Agda said.

“This event not only promotes environmental advocacy but also showcases the beauty and hospitality of our community. We look forward to a memorable and impactful experience for everyone involved,” the city mayor added.

This is the first time that Borongan, the capital of Eastern Samar province, will be hosting a national pageant, particularly on beachwear scheduled at Baybay Beach.

The competition will be joined by 29 candidates representing various local government units from Luzon, Visayas, and Mindanao.

They will be joined by the reigning Miss Philippines Earth 2024 Yllana Marie Aduana.
It was learned that the candidates will not only visit Borongan for the swimwear competition but will also visit other places in Eastern Samar to promote advocacy work focusing on environmental protection.

Miss Philippines Earth 2024 is set to be crowned this May 11, 2024 in Talakag, Bukidnon. The winner will represent the country at the Miss Earth 2024 competition which is scheduled to be held in a South American country.

Miss Earth is a Philippine-based international pageant that advocates for environmental awareness, conservation, and social responsibility.
